How much does it cost to rent a home in Southeast DeKalb?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Southeast DeKalb 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,873 | $949 | $9,000 |
| Southeast DeKalb 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,096 | $800 | $10,000+ |
| Southeast DeKalb 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,535 | $630 | $10,000+ |
| Southeast DeKalb 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,386 | $900 | $10,000+ |
| Southeast DeKalb 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,820 | $1,920 | $10,000+ |
| Southeast DeKalb 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,350 | $3,250 | $3,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Southeast DeKalb
What type of rentals are currently available in Southeast DeKalb?
There are currently 857 Apartments for Rent in Southeast DeKalb, GA with pricing that ranges from $637 to $19,152. There are also 1629 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Southeast DeKalb ranging from $365 to $20,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Southeast DeKalb?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Southeast DeKalb ranges from $365 to $20,000 with an average monthly rent of $3,254.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Southeast DeKalb?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Southeast DeKalb range from $830 to $8,335,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$800 to $10,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$630 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,335.
